Bayern Munich have dealt a major blow to Liverpool’s transfer ambitions after reportedly moving to tie down Michael Olise to a new long-term contract that could keep him at the Allianz Arena until 2031. The 23-year-old French winger has taken the Bundesliga by storm since arriving from Crystal Palace, and his meteoric rise has now made him one of the most sought-after players in Europe.
According to reports from CF Bayern Insider, Liverpool — who have long admired Olise — were preparing to make a move for him in 2026 as part of their strategy to identify a long-term successor for Mohamed Salah. However, Bayern’s sporting director Max Eberl has now confirmed that the club plans to offer Olise an improved deal and that he has no release clause in his current contract, effectively placing Bayern in full control of his future.
Olise has already been described as “sensational” by pundits and teammates alike after contributing 35 goals in 51 appearances across all competitions during his debut season. His dazzling dribbling, deadly left foot, and mature decision-making have transformed Bayern’s attacking dynamics under Vincent Kompany, who has made him a central figure in his fluid, high-tempo system.
This season, the Frenchman has continued where he left off, recording five goals and four assists in all competitions — impressive numbers that highlight his growing importance to the team. His chemistry with Harry Kane and Luis Díaz has turned Bayern into one of the most unpredictable and creative attacking units in Europe.
